#4bf521 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4bf521 is composed of 29.4% red, 96.1% green and 12.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 86.5%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 108.1 degrees, a saturation of 91.4% and a lightness of 54.5%. #4bf521 color hex could be obtained by blending #96ff42 with #00eb00. Closest websafe color is: #33ff33.

● #4bf521 color description : Vivid lime green.
#4bf521 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4bf521 has RGB values of R:75, G:245, B:33 and CMYK values of C:0.69, M:0, Y:0.87,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 4977953.

Shades and Tints of #4bf521
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010300 is the darkest color, while #f2feef is the lightest one.

Tones of #4bf521
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#869383 is the less saturated color, while #46fe18 is the most saturated one.
